Transaction 159aa77091e40ac8e38a5d80224811e47df79877fa33aa86a3b30e9a00da717b
1 Input
2 Outputs
- 159aa77091e40ac8e38a5d80224811e47df79877fa33aa86a3b30e9a00da717b:0
- 159aa77091e40ac8e38a5d80224811e47df79877fa33aa86a3b30e9a00da717b:1
value 1400000
address 38enf96HCtBpXjAkjfKeQDVxRmEvBz55TV
value 2995473
address 1MCFVJDDUXfwTfDUbJbgS7RqpJRgpr6RQC